Huffman encoding and decoding This program was developed for a data structures and algorithms master project.
It creates a huffman tree based on a min heap. A variety of file types can be encoded and decoded.
In order to run complie all the files. To encode a file: java henc5191 This will encode the file with a .huf on the end of it
To decode a file with a .huf (this will replace a file if the name of that file already exists): java hdec5191